W94.31 ICD 10 Code is a non-billable and non-specific code and should not be used to indicate a diagnosis for reimbursement purposes. There are other codes below it with greater level of diagnosis detail. The 2023 edition of the American ICD-10-CM code became effective on October 1, 2022.
Short description for W94.31 ICD 10 code:
Exposure to chng in air pressure in aircraft during descent
Codes
- W94.31XA Exposure to sudden change in air pressure in aircraft during descent, initial encounter
- W94.31XD Exposure to sudden change in air pressure in aircraft during descent, subsequent encounter
- W94.31XS Exposure to sudden change in air pressure in aircraft during descent, sequela
